Output d96113d21ede31bf3a60e19853d5ce926d09f15c3540a4f2440bb4e960d2d532:0

value
26113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b78eb4df2444320c320e3c5ff1b0308942ec406b OP_EQUAL
address
3JRaY59HYrSqsvg9CfR5eTorfJbDovSToU
transaction
d96113d21ede31bf3a60e19853d5ce926d09f15c3540a4f2440bb4e960d2d532
confirmations
131045
spent
true